Re: Black Sabbath: Metal or Not?
That's not a good description of death metal at all. 16th notes change duration depending on what tempo (BPM) you're playing in. At 80 bpm 16 notes are obviously slower than if they were played at say 200 bpm. Secondly, the bass pedal is usually used to follow the guitar line, used to add a little kick to the palm mutes, and without the intensity of the drums the music wouldn't feel as fast or chaotic, which is kind of what most death metal bands are going for. Although I do agree on your Sabbath comment, I don't know who would try and argue they aren't metal.
